Merge new vendor release - 6.2.9.
Details: o if_em.c changes: - Added several new PCI ids. - Check em_check_phy_reset_block() before doing SIOCSIFMEDIA ioctl. - Don't touch TARC registers, they are now handled in shared code in if_em_hw.c. - Move RDH and RDT setting to the end of em_initialize_receive_unit(). - Declare em_read_pcie_cap_reg(), now empty. o if_em_hw.c dropped in from vendor, then restored rev. 1.15. o if_em_hw.h dropped in from vendor, then modified: - Added RX overrun interrupt flag to interrupt enable mask. - Remove declarations of em_io_read(), em_io_write().
